Table of ContentsTypes of Neuromuscular Blocking AgentsDepolarizing Agents: Non-depolarizing Agents: Mechanism of ActionPharmacokineticsSide EffectsContraindicationsClinical UsesNeuromuscular blocking agents are a class of drugs that are used to induce muscle relaxation, typically during surgical procedures, mechanical ventilation, or endotracheal intubation. These agents work by interfering with the transmission of nerve impulses to the muscles, leading to paralysis. … Continue reading Neuromuscular Blocking Agents
